Radestrian
Etymology
From Middle Radestrian airt, from Old Radestrian ajrtt, inherited from Proto-Radic *ajrhht, from Proto-Hirdic *ájrəp̄-, from Proto-Laenkean *m̥ɟŕ̥p-.
Pronunciation
Verb
ert (transitive, first-person singular non-past ere, first-person singular past erșei, present adverbial participle erșevú, past adverbial participle ergúl, verbal noun ergaș)
- to yield, to result in
- to mean, to entail, to engender
- Bitad gjøș kjes èr a gyvúza?
- What does this mean for the future?
- to mean, to signify
- Synonym: jást
- Bitad gjøș èr kjeșa rjaovs?
- What does this word mean?
- to mean (be sincere about)
- Èr gjøn-ast?
- Do you mean it?
- to claim, to say, to think
- Vâs erșeș, eș ets traiș.
- He thought it was kinda dull.
- (intransitive, colloquial) to make sense
- Synonym: redvebt dzist
